What is the difference between Korean and Western makeup styles?

Korean makeup emphasizes poreless skin, gradient lips (darker at edges, lighter in center), puppy-eye liner, and natural glow. Western styles use full contouring, defined brows, and matte finishes. Korean approach requires meticulous base work; Western approach builds dimension. Vietnamese humidity demands primers and long-wear formulas for both.

Why book a makeup trial before your wedding or event?

A trial session (typically 45–60 minutes) lets you test the artist's understanding of Korean aesthetics, product compatibility with your skin tone, and longevity in Hanoi's climate. Trials also reveal whether the artist listens to your photo references and adapts to your face shape. Many brides discover during trial that their preferred lip tone photographs differently or that contour melts faster than expected. Trials cost less than full service and let you adjust for the real day without stress.

What does skin prep look like for Korean makeup in Hanoi humidity?

Hanoi's heat and moisture (70–90% humidity June–September) break down makeup unless base is bulletproof. Korean makeup requires: primer on T-zone, hydrating base for dry areas, and setting spray throughout. Many travelers expect matte finish; Korean style demands dewy skin that holds sheen. Artists use layered base (essence, BB cream, light powder) and long-wear lip tints designed for sweat and eating. If you have combination skin, expect the artist to use different formulas per zone—forehead gets matte control, cheeks stay luminous. Request a makeup trial if you've never worn Korean style in tropical heat; it feels different and needs adjustment.

What should you check before confirming your makeup artist?

  1. Portfolio fit: Do their Korean makeup examples match your preferred brow shape, lip gradient, and eye style?
  2. Trial included?: Confirm trial cost, duration, and whether it's deducted from event-day fee.
  3. Product ingredients: Mention allergies or sensitive skin to the artist before booking—they'll select compatible formulas.
  4. Humidity-proofing: Ask which primers, setting sprays, and lip products survive Hanoi heat and humidity.
  5. Touch-up plan: Clarify whether artist provides touch-up kits for your event or teaches you to refresh during the day.
  6. Cancellation policy: Confirm deposit terms and whether you can reschedule if flights change.
  7. Travel scope: Verify the artist serves your hotel or venue address—some areas require travel surcharges.
  8. Language: Confirm the artist speaks English fluently enough to discuss makeup references and adjustments.

FAQ

Can a makeup artist in Vietnam match Korean makeup to my skin undertone if I'm not East Asian?

Yes. Korean technique translates to all skin tones—gradient lips, dewy base, and puppy eyes work universally. Share photos of Korean makeup on skin tones similar to yours; the artist adjusts product shade but keeps the aesthetic.

What happens if my makeup melts in Hanoi humidity on my wedding day?

Artists provide setting spray, powder, and (if requested) a touch-up kit so you can refresh without reapplying. Discuss humidity concerns at trial; they'll adjust primer or base formula.

Is a trial required, or can I book full makeup without one?

Trials are optional but strongly advised, especially if you've never worn Korean makeup or the artist is new to you. They prevent surprises and ensure the artist understands your vision and skin needs.

Do I need to buy Korean makeup products to get Korean makeup done?

No. The artist supplies products for your appointment. Korean makeup does use specific formulas (long-wear lip tints, hydrating bases) that may differ from Western equivalents—ask which brand the artist uses.

How long does Korean makeup take compared to Western makeup?

Korean style requires 45–75 minutes due to meticulous base layering and gradual blending. Western makeup is typically 30–45 minutes. Ask your artist for a realistic timeline during booking.

Can I take a makeup class to learn Korean technique for daily wear?

Yes. 1-to-1 makeup classes teach you step-by-step. One session covers primer, base, blending, and lip gradient. Most travelers complete one 60–90 minute class and practice at home afterward.

What's the best time of year to book a makeup artist in Vietnam?

October–May offers lower humidity and easier scheduling. June–September is hot and humid—artists adjust formulas and may book 2–3 weeks out. Always book at least 1 week ahead year-round for trials.
